Question: Please guide for oral contraceptives dose and use,age 32 years.Period cycle 24-26 days regular.No BP and sugar

There are various types of oral contraceptive pills are available.

Usually Combined oral contraceptive pills containing Ethinyl Estradiol (0.03mg) and Desogestrel (0.15mg) are used.

First dose should be on Day 1 of menstrual cycle. If its pack of 21 tablets, continue medications for 21 days (daily one Tablet ) and wait for 7 days and restart the same course irrespective of bleeding.

If its pack of 28 tablets than it may contains 7 days of iron tablets.

If you miss tablet than use other contraceptive e. g. condom for 2 days along with tablet.

Sometimes you may feel minor side effects like nausea, headache, stomach pain. In case of irregular/heavy bleeding, consult with gynaecologist sos.
